112 Fair dealing between lessor and tenant about renewal of
shopping centre lease
(1) If the lessor fails to comply with section 108 (Rules of conduct at end
of lease term for shopping centre leases) in relation to premises in the
retail area of a shopping centre and the tenant is prejudiced by the
failure, the tenant may apply to the Magistrates Court.
Note Under s 52 (Market rent—rent reviews, options and renewals) the lessor
or tenant may ask the Magistrates Court to refer a dispute about the rent
to be paid under a renewal to mediation.
(2) On application under this section, the Magistrates Court may make
any order it considers appropriate.

(3) Without limiting subsection (2), the Magistrates Court may—
(a) order the lessor to renew or extend the lease, or to enter into a
new lease with the tenant, on terms approved by the court (but
not to the prejudice of the rights of a third-party who has
honestly acquired an interest in the premises); or
(b) order the lessor to pay compensation (not more than 6 months
rent under the lease) to the tenant.
